Type: Association
Opened in 2001

Address: Observatoire de Marseille, 2 place Le Verrier - 13004 Marseille
Country: FRANCE
Email: andromede.13@live.fr
Phone: +33 (0)4-13-55-21-55

Website: http://andromede.id.st/
     
           

Team
Jacques Gispert (president)
Lionel Ruiz (director)
Richard Hamou
Laurent Ferrero







30 seats











Dome of  6.0m




Technical
Digital system LSS : Heligon-Peleng
Software: SpaceCrafter 2023 Pro
Video system Optoma : 4K550
Video Lens: Fisheye
Meridian resolution 2.1 K
Sound 8.1

Facilities
Exhibit area: 150m²
Observatory T800mm (Foucault 1862), L260mm (Merz-Eichens 1872)
Portable: 2 portables (LSS + Digitarium Alpha)

Operation
Frequenting: 24000 people per year
Sessions: 580 per year
Staff: 3 people

History
- 1702: first observatory (other location)
~ 1870: new location (observatory)
- 1976: Andromede association founded
- January 1987: Goto EX3
- October 2001: Cosmodyssee III
- July 2005: Digitarium Alpha
- October 2016: new seats
- Summer 2018: Projector 4K
- 2025: project for 9m dome, 70s, tited, next to the 6m dome planetarium

Last major evolution: 2005: Digital
